Typora大纲设置教程:自定义头级样式和无链接下划线

需积分: 0 4 下载量 31 浏览量 更新于2024-08-04 收藏 5KB MD 举报
在本文档中,我们将学习如何在Typora中自定义大纲视图以获得更专业且个性化的文档结构显示。Typora是一款轻量级的Markdown编辑器,其简洁的界面深受用户喜爱。本文将指导你如何设置一个清晰的大纲结构,以便更好地组织和查看文档内容。 首先,我们从打开Typora的偏好设置开始。找到并点击"打开主题文件夹"按钮,这通常位于菜单栏中的某个位置,如下图所示:![image-20230416212044631](C:\Users\86138\AppData\Roaming\Typora\typora-user-images\image-20230416212044631.png)这一步是定位到Typora的主题文件夹,这样可以对默认样式进行个性化修改。 接着,创建一个新的`base.user.css`文件。这是一个自定义CSS文件,它允许你添加或修改 Typora 的样式,而不影响其核心功能。在Typora的安装目录下的`AppData\Roaming\Typora`文件夹内找到并创建这个文件:![image-20230416212223827](C:\Users\86138\AppData\Roaming\Typora\typora-user-images\image-20230416212223827.png) 在`base.user.css`中,我们将添加一些代码来定制TOC(Table of Contents,目录)的样式,以及去除链接下划线,使大纲看起来更为整洁。以下是关键部分的代码: ```css / HeaderCountersinTOC / /* 去除TOC链接下划线 */ .md-toc-inner { text-decoration: none; } /* 设置各级标题的样式 */ .md-toc-content { counter-reset: h1toc; /* 初始化计数器 */ } .md-toc-h1 { margin-left: 0; font-size: 1.5rem; counter-reset: h2toc; } .md-toc-h2 { font-size: 1.1rem; margin-left: 2rem; counter-reset: h3toc; } .md-toc-h3 { margin-left: 3rem; font-size: 0.9rem; counter-reset: h4toc; } .md-toc-h4 { margin-left: 4rem; font-size: 0.85rem; counter-reset: h5toc; } .md-toc-h5 { margin-left: 5rem; font-size: 0.8rem; counter-reset: h6toc; } .md-toc-h6 { margin-left: 6rem; font-size: 0.75rem; } /* 在每个级别的标题前添加计数器 */ .md-toc-h1:before { color: black; counter-increment: h1toc; content: counter(h1toc) "."; /* 显示当前标题的级别编号 */ } ``` 这段代码的作用是为每一级标题(h1到h6)增加一个编号,并且去除它们在TOC中的下划线,使得大纲看起来更加清晰和专业。通过在每个标题前添加数字,读者可以快速了解每个部分的层级关系。 最后,记得保存`base.user.css`文件并重启Typora,新的样式会立即生效。这样,你就可以在撰写文档时享受更加美观且有序的大纲视图,方便管理复杂的文档结构。 总结起来,本教程向你展示了如何在Typora中通过自定义CSS来设置和优化大纲视图,让你的Markdown文档显得更加专业。理解并应用这些步骤,可以极大地提升你的写作体验和文档可读性。